Haunted by my cyber-past

Sometimes I think the Internet is just too fucking smart for its own good.
Recently I've been doing some cyber-shopping for things I can't find in local stores: stuff like Falke brand hosiery and Simone Perele lingerie. I can only assume that my materialistic Web searches are stored for eternity in my browser's memory, as the same items I shopped for are now popping up on other Web pages.
It's kind of embarrassing to try and look at an innocuous site like Yahoo, only to be deluged with banner ads that will take me directly to the shiny Falke stockings I was looking at three days ago.
If I go ahead and order, will the curse be lifted? I'm going to try clearing my browser's history first as I'm saving up for various car and motorcycle repairs.
